Just wondered if you'd checked the single engine service ceiling with the chart, and how it compared to your actual experience? I know that with the racks full and wieght up that the ceiling can be below sea level. The red button to jettison everything was the first thing to hit if you lost an engine at low altitude when the Air Force was flying them. Unfortunately, the FAA frowns on us dropping things under any circumstances, so it's a little more of a problem.
